The most recent cargo provide mission headed to China’s Tiangong house station lifted off on Monday, July 14, at 21:40 UTC. A Chang Zheng 7 rocket lofted the Tianzhou 9 (or “heavenly ship”) cargo car from pad LC-201 on the Wenchang House Launch Website on the island of Hainan.
Prematurely of this mission, the earlier Tianzhou 8 car undocked from the Tianhe aft port on the station on July 9 and broke up upon reentry into Earth’s environment. Tianzhou 9 docked to Tiangong on the Tianhe port roughly three hours after liftoff. Onboard have been meals, garments, and different consumables for the Shenzhou 20 crew, along with life assist provides, scientific experiments, propellants for stationkeeping, and different gadgets for station upkeep.
Additionally aboard have been two upgraded Feitian extravehicular exercise (EVA) fits, which can change a pair that have been disposed of on Tianzhou 8. The brand new fits have a lifespan of 20 usages over 4 years. The outgoing pair of fits had already far exceeded their designed 15-use lifespans and have been one spacewalk shy of this upgraded aim.
Tianzhou 9 is anticipated to spend six to seven months on the station and measures 10.6 m lengthy and three.35 m in diameter. The car docks autonomously and may carry as much as 7,400 kg of cargo. SpaceX’s Cargo Dragon, by comparability, can carry round 6,000 kg of pressurized and unpressurized cargo, whereas Cygnus can carry 3,750 kg. Each of those autos are as a consequence of fly resupply missions to the Worldwide House Station (ISS) aboard Falcon 9 autos within the subsequent two to a few months.
Falcon 9 | Starlink Group 15-2
A Falcon 9 launched a batch of 26 Starlink v2-Mini web satellites into low-Earth orbit (LEO) on Tuesday, July 15. Liftoff passed off from House Launch Complicated 4 East (SLC-4E) on the Vandenberg House Drive Base in California on the prime of a launch window at 7:05 PM PDT (02:05 UTC on Wednesday, July 16).
Regardless of the mission title, SpaceX had already launched eight different flights into the Group 15 shell of its Starlink constellation. Each launch into this shell has occurred from SLC-4E, and this was the primary launch from the pad because the Group 15-7 mission in late June, which marked the five hundredth flight of Falcon 9.
Following deployment, the satellites will make their solution to an orbit at 535 km altitude, inclined 70 levels. Booster B1093 supported this mission on its fourth flight and efficiently landed downrange on the west coast droneship Of Course I Nonetheless Love You. Thus far, it had lofted three different batches into the Group 15 shell of the Starlink constellation. Firstly of the week, SpaceX had launched 9,165 Starlink satellites. Of those, 1,197 have reentered Earth’s environment, and seven,028 have moved into their operational orbits.
A yr has now handed because the second-stage engine didn’t restart throughout SpaceX’s Starlink Group 9-3 mission, ending a streak of 325 consecutive profitable missions for the corporate. SpaceX has since rebuilt the depend of consecutive Falcon missions to just about half that through the 12 months since that anomaly on July 12, 2024 — the streak stood at 149 on the finish of final week’s Business GTO-1 mission. SpaceX, due to this fact, reached a notable milestone with Starlink Group 15-2, marking the one hundred and fiftieth profitable mission in a row.

Falcon 9 | Mission Kuiper (KF-01)
SpaceX has launched its first contracted batch of Amazon’s Kuiper satellites on Wednesday, July 16, from House Launch Complicated 40 (SLC-40) on the Cape Canaveral House Drive Station in Florida.
Liftoff occurred at 2:30 AM EDT (06:30 UTC), carrying 24 of the satellites to LEO. The primary stage supporting this mission was B1096 on its maiden flight. The booster efficiently landed on the SpaceX droneship A Shortfall of Gravitas after taking a northeasterly trajectory.
Kuiper satellites are deliberate to occupy 98 orbital planes in layers at altitudes of 590 km, 610 km, and 630 km. To satisfy expectations in its license from the Federal Communications Fee (FCC), the complete constellation of three,236 satellites have to be launched by the tip of July 2029. The extra urgent deadline is in a single yr’s time, when Amazon is required to have deployed half of its constellation — 1,618 of the satellites — by July 30, 2026.
To this finish, two additional launches have been booked aboard Falcon 9 and can fly within the subsequent quarter, 12 are booked aboard Blue Origin’s New Glenn, and 18 aboard Arianespace’s Ariane 6.
The United Launch Alliance’s (ULA) Atlas V has already lofted two preliminary batches of 27 Kuiper satellites, with one batch launching in April and one other in June. ULA will now swap to its Vulcan rocket, within the VC6L configuration with six strong boosters, to hold not less than yet another batch to LEO by the tip of the yr. ULA has been contracted to launch 38 missions for the constellation.
As famous above, this mission is because of develop into the one hundred and fiftieth consecutive profitable Falcon mission because the anomaly through the Starlink Group 9-3 mission this time final yr.
Falcon 9 | Starlink Group 17-3
A second Falcon 9 launch from SLC-4E in Vandenberg lifted off the pad on Wednesday, July 16, at 8:52 PM PDT (03:52 UTC on July 17), roughly midway by the four-hour launch window. Starlink Group 17-3 was the second mission to hold 24 into the Group 17 shell of the Starlink constellation, the primary of which launched from this similar pad nearly two months in the past. This had been the primary Starlink launch to a Solar-synchronous orbital inclination in over two years.
The booster supporting this mission was B1082 on its 14th flight. Lively for a yr and a half, this primary stage has supported two authorities missions and the OneWeb 20 launch along with a collection of different missions for the Starlink constellation.
The booster landed efficiently downrange on the droneship Of Course I Nonetheless Love You round eight minutes into the mission. As with the earlier Group 17 mission, Falcon 9 flew nearly immediately south into an orbit with an inclination of over 97 levels. Following deployment, the satellites will make their solution to an orbit at an altitude of 535 km.

Two extra second-generation satellites massing round 3,400 kg are as a consequence of fly aboard a Falcon 9 and additional construct out the 03b mPower community for SES-owned 03b Networks. Liftoff is scheduled on the prime of a two-hour window which opens on Monday, July 21 at 5:12 PM EDT (21:12 UTC) from SLC-40 on the Cape Canaveral House Drive Station in Florida.
SpaceX has beforehand lofted 4 different pairs of those satellites right into a medium-Earth orbit because the first two launched in December 2022. The latest launch for the constellation was in late December 2024, when the booster supporting this mission, B1090, made its debut.
This would be the sixth flight for this primary stage, which has additionally supported the Crew-10 and Bandwagon-3 missions earlier this yr. The booster is anticipated to land on the deck of the SpaceX droneship Simply Learn The Directions, which will likely be ready downrange within the Atlantic Ocean.

Gilmour House was anticipated to make a second try on the maiden launch of its Eris small satellite tv for pc rocket on Wednesday, July 16, at 7:30 AM AEST (21:30 UTC on Tuesday, July 15). The try has been pushed again to no sooner than July 26, nonetheless, as a consequence of operational delays and higher wind forecasts for the remainder of this week.
The corporate stood down from its earlier try, which was scheduled for Could 16, after the fairings have been prematurely triggered by the separation system throughout in a single day launch preparations. An sudden energy surge from different gadgets downstream had prompted the car to close down, inflicting the difficulty, which has since been mitigated.
The launch will happen from the Bowen Orbital Spaceport at Abbot Level, north of the coastal city of Bowen. As the symbol on the rocket physique proudly declares, the three-stage launcher is “Australian-made.” TestFlight 1 is poised to develop into the primary orbital launch from Australian soil carried out by a sovereign-built car.

Akin to Rocket Lab’s Electron, Eris stands a bit of taller at 25 m in peak. The car additionally has a barely bigger 1.5 m fairing and boasts a payload mass of as much as 215 kg to a 500 km Solar-synchronous orbit, or 305 kg to 500 km equatorial orbits. The primary stage is propelled by 4 Sirius engines — a proprietary hybrid engine that makes use of a 3D-printed strong gasoline grain and hydrogen peroxide because the oxidizer. A single Sirius engine powers the second stage. A profitable orbital launch would even be the primary for a hybrid rocket design.
Gilmour House introduced final week that it had signed a brand new partnership with Tokyo-based House BD that can open up devoted and rideshare alternatives aboard its Eris rocket and ElaraSat platform for Japanese and international satellite tv for pc prospects.
